Stylish, comfortable space and an inviting patio that I'm sure is very appealing when the weather is nicer. Came in for Happy Hour in the bar area, but only ordered a $3 Coors Light draft and $6 Chardonnay off that menu. Crab dip was good. Came with plenty of kettle chips. Maple-glazed salmon was very good. The squash and shredded Brussels stacked under rather than on the side was a little unexpected, but it worked. An overall sweet profile. Great service from bartender Bonnie and good value overall. Would recommend especially if you're right in the neighborhood.

We arrived right at opening of 5PM and there was a small crowd outside. Easy to find parking in this quiet, residential area. The outdoor dining is super cute. Great breeze and comfortable space to eat. Michael was our server - great guy! We had to change our seats due to the sun burning our backs and they accommodated without hesitation. Ordered a few things to try - all delicious! Atlantic salmon - the star of the show. No wonder so many people order this. I'm not sure how they do it but cooked exceptionally well on the inside with a lovely seared crispy yet glazed crust. The quinoa was great with it and the sauce was divine. Shrimp and grits - I always love a good sauce with cheesy grits. Generous portion of shrimp. Wasn't a big fan of the chorizo as it was a bit hard. Baby Kale salad - SO good. The combination of feta cheese, strawberries and candied almonds works so well with the lemon vinaigrette. A very refreshing salad that greatly compliments your meal. Crab cakes - great shareable portion with yummy slaw. At this point, we had so much food, we had to stuff ourselves but it was good dish. Love the service, food and atmosphere here. Would definitely come back if we are in the area. They are super kid-friendly which I'm always very appreciative of.

Too bad we can't eat the atmosphere in Bodhi Kitchen, Rehoboth Beach. It is the best part of the…read moreexperience. Thereafter, the food on the "Asian Fusion" menu sounds great, but leaves much to be desired. More confusion, than fusion. Dumpling Special is a cool notion (why not save a few bucks?). But, when it arrives without ginseng slivers, nor a spoon for dripping the dark vinegar into the removed top knot to mix with the beef soup within the Xiao Long Bau, it becomes apparent skill is lacking in the kitchen. It doesn't help that these dough pouches are commercially bought and not made by knowing hands. The Singapore Black Pepper Crab bowl was sure Szechuan spicy enough, but had so little crab that my crustacean loving wife turned on her phone flashlight to find some. They were ground so small that they were nearly invisible, but could be slightly tasted by their mild sweetness. Just not enough substance to balance the other ingredients. My Cumin Lamb Ho Fun was likewise deep into the heat and looked good with the fat noodles mixed throughout. However, once again the kitchen's lack of deftness appeared with too many tough, stringy and fatty pieces of lamb that were unpleasant and overbore the generally decent quality of the rest of the dish. From my experience, that only happens when attention isn't paid to the texture of the meat when slicing. Cutting lamb against the grain is a no-no. So, even though I enjoyed the Moon Door entrance, the Bodhi (Enlightenment) name and all the on point Asian decor, it was disappointing that all that spirituality stopped at the kitchen door. 2.5 Shakyamuni-less Stars.
